Honor has launched the Honor X9C, a premium mid-range smartphone that brings together stylish aesthetics, a curved AMOLED display, 5G performance, and a large battery to target users who want a high-end look and feel without the flagship price tag. With its ultra-slim profile, smooth display, and reliable internals, the X9C positions itself as a powerful everyday driver with flagship-style elegance.
Premium Design with Curved AMOLED Display
The Honor X9C features a 6.78-inch FHD+ A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ate and curved edges, offering immersive visuals and a premium feel in hand. The thin bezels, centrally placed punch-hole camera, and lightweight build make it an eye-catching phone ideal for both media consumption and daily use.
Powered by Snapdragon 6 Gen 1 Chipset
Under the hood, the device runs on the Qualcomm Snapdragon 6 Gen 1 SoC, which offers smooth multitasking, reliable 5G connectivity, and balanced efficiency. It comes with up to 12GB RAM and 256GB internal storage, allowing for seamless switching between apps, gaming, and productivity tasks.
108MP AI Triple Camera System
Photography is another strong suit of the Honor X9C. The rear camera setup includes a 108MP main sensor, a 5MP ultrawide lens, and a 2MP depth sensor. This configuration enables detailed shots, enhanced low-light photography, and wide-angle group photos. The 16MP front camera delivers quality selfies with beauty modes and AI enhancements.
5100mAh Battery with 35W Fast Charging
The phone is powered by a 5100mAh battery, offering excellent battery backup for all-day use. It supports 35W fast charging, which quickly brings the phone back to life during busy days without long charging delays.
MagicOS Based on Android 13
Running on MagicOS 7.2 based on Android 13, the X9C offers smart features like multi-window multitasking, customizable UI, performance optimization tools, and enhanced privacy settings. The UI is smooth, modern, and well-optimized for everyday use.
Price and Availability
The Honor X9C is expected to be priced around ₹24,999 to ₹27,999 in India for the base variant. It is available via Amazon, Flipkart, Honor’s official website, and retail stores, with launch offers like bank discounts, no-cost EMI, and exchange bonuses.
